The Senior Financial Analyst provides financial support to Kraton's management teams by ensuring best-in-class financial processes and financial reporting is provided to key internal and external stakeholders; compliance with the required International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S); driving Kraton’s ability to report reliable and accurate information about the business; and partnering with the commercial and operating teams to derive shareholder value. The role involves supporting budgets, forecasts, business plan validation, and delivering accurate performance reports. The candidate should have 5 to 10 years of finance experience, knowledge of accounting policies, advanced Excel and PowerPoint skills, SAP experience, and a degree in finance or accounting. The position is based in Jacksonville, FL, USA.

Responsibilities
- Support in the preparation of budgets, operating plans, forecasts, and investment strategies for Transformation Office.
- Critically review and actively contribute to building the business plan, validating implementation outcome, supports calculations for actuals and forecast, reconciling results with the P&L.
- Co-drives results with other stakeholders to achieve ambitious company set targets.
- Provide timely, relevant and accurate reporting & analysis of the results of the company's performance against historical, budgeted, forecasted and strategic planning results to facilitate decision-making.
- Build and enhance reporting to provide meaningful insight into current and future performance.
- Liaise directly with different Transformation Office stakeholders for financial insight on both current period analytics as well as point of view development for forecast builds.
- Manage delivery of key reporting metrics for Kraton Leadership Team.
- Perform ad hoc reports and other analyses and special projects as requested.

Requirements
- 5 to 10 years of experience in finance and accounting
- Knowledge of accounting policies and practices
- Excellent problem solving skills
- Advanced Excel and PowerPoint skills
- SAP experience (FI/COPA/BI) preferred
